The suspected hackers have breached US water infrastucture before – and CISA has just warned their targets are expanding.
In at least one city, the attack temporarily knocked a municipal well and water treatment plant offline, according to local media outlet MPRNews.
Other communities reported the attacks disrupted communications and automated operations, forcing staff to switch to manual workarounds while systems were restored, the news outlet said.
